Is DSL the fastest internet I can get in Holt County?
The fastest internet for you may vary based on where in Holt County you live. In general, fiber competes most often with DSL in the county.
- Fiber is the fastest internet type for 70.32% of Holt County homes.
- Cable is fastest for less than 1% of the county.
- DSL is fastest for 2.93%.
- Fixed wireless is fastest for 22.48%.
- Satellite internet may be the only option for 4.27% of Holt County homes.
